Reporting Analyst - Power BI, BI Tools, Healthcare

Oracle
Boston, MA

Job Description

Oracle Health Government Services is seeking a skilled Reporting Analyst to join our mission-driven organization. The Reporting Analyst will work closely with government stakeholders, integration leadership, data management teams, and project managers to ensure accurate, timely, and reliable reporting in support of deployment, integration, escalation, and executive decision-making.

This role manages complex schedule creation for a wide variety of applications and systems used by the client. The position serves as an important member of our integration team, supporting the scheduling activities required for delivery of all interface-related deployment activities. The ideal candidate will have proven success working with development teams as well as other internal stakeholders to provide information required for meeting contract deadlines.

Responsibilities *: *

  • Ensure quality assurance and data integrity across all reports, dashboards, and data extracts.

  • Monitor, maintain, and update reporting and interface tracking artifacts using SharePoint and other enterprise tools.

  • Collect, validate, analyze, and reconcile qualitative and quantitative data from multiple data sources.

  • Work within established communication and governance processes to receive, document, and disseminate updates from integration of leadership, change management, and reporting teams.

  • Coordinate with internal teams (Microsoft Project Manager, JIRA, Data Management, CGS Analytics, Power BI, Apex) to ensure reporting updates align with deployment milestones, localization activities, and cutover events.

  • Prepare, review, and distribute recurring and ad hoc reports to internal leadership and government clients.

  • Draft clear, concise PowerPoint presentations and executive-level briefing materials.

  • Support escalation reporting, executive briefings, and stakeholder communications.

  • Attend and/or facilitate internal and external meetings as required

  • Attend and/or facilitate external client meetings, including list synchronization meetings.

  • Produce executive-level reports and dashboards.

Top skills or competencies to be successful:

  • Business Intelligence Reporting experience

  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and data validation skills.

  • Highly organized and detail oriented.

Education, certifications, or experience (preferred/required):

  • Bachelor's plus a minimum of 5 years of reporting, business intelligence, or data analysis experience.

  • Highly proficient in Microsoft Office tools, including Excel, PowerPoint, Word, SharePoint, and PowerBI.

  • Efficient with written and oral communication

  • Familiar with Office 365 applications such as Word, Outlook,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.

  • Experience with Milestone Pro preferred

  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and data validation skills.

  • Ability to communicate effectively with stakeholders across multiple levels of management.

  • Previous Federal Contracting experience preferred.

  • Required travel up to 20%

  • US Citizenship is required with an ability to obtain and maintain a government security clearance.

Range and benefit information provided in this posting are specific to the stated locations only

US: Hiring Range in USD from: $87,000 to $178,100 per annum. May be eligible for bonus and equity.

Oracle maintains broad salary ranges for its roles in order to account for variations in knowledge, skills, experience, market conditions and locations, as well as reflect Oracle's differing products, industries and lines of business.

Candidates are typically placed into the range based on the preceding factors as well as internal peer equity.

Oracle US offers a comprehensive benefits package which includes the following:

Medical, dental, and vision insurance, including expert medical opinion

Short term disability and long term disability

Life insurance and AD&D

Supplemental life insurance (Employee/Spouse/Child)

Health care and dependent care Flexible Spending Accounts

Pre-tax commuter and parking benefits

401(k) Savings and Investment Plan with company match

Paid time off: Flexible Vacation is provided to all eligible employees assigned to a salaried (non-overtime eligible) position. Accrued Vacation is provided to all other employees eligible for vacation benefits. For employees working at least 35 hours per week, the vacation accrual rate is 13 days annually for the first three years of employment and 18 days annually for subsequent years of employment. Vacation accrual is prorated for employees working between 20 and 34 hours per week. Employees working fewer than 20 hours per week are not eligible for vacation.

11 paid holidays

Paid sick leave: 72 hours of paid sick leave upon date of hire. Refreshes each calendar year. Unused balance will carry over each year up to a maximum cap of 112 hours.
